EDS
noun [ U ] medical specialized /ˌiː.diːˈes/ /ˌiː.diːˈes/
埃莱尔—当洛综合征(Ehlers-Danlos Syndrome的缩写)
abbreviation for Ehlers-Danlos syndrome : a group of inherited conditions (= ones passed from parent to child) affecting connective tissue (= the tissue that supports the structure of skin, bones, organs, etc.), which may for example allow the skin to stretch too much or the body to bend too easily
Patients with EDS present with hyper-elasticity of the skin and hypermobile joints. 埃莱尔—当洛综合征患者表现为皮肤弹性过度和关节活动过度。
EDS is a genetic condition that affects connective tissue, the type of tissue in the body that provides support, structure, stability and normal scar formation.

  • Ehlers-Danlos Syndrome (EDS) refers to a group of heritable connective tissue disorders.
  • The causes of menorrhagia are multiple and can include vitamin K deficiency and EDS (Ehlers-Danlos syndrome).
  • The two most common types of EDS are the classic type and hypermobile type, which feature soft skin with varying degrees of stretchiness and poor wound healing.
  • Some individuals with EDS (up to 25%) may have cardiac complications.
